I would like to become an Adobe Stock contributor. Before submitting my content (I am the author) I would like to know if it has to be registered first in a copyright office in order to show I own the copyright?

Thank you

No. Registration just only proves that you are the author of the work in a more formal way. Copyright is attributed by doing a work, not by registering the work.

You just go ahead and upload your work. You may be required to provide property release for some of your works, but no formal copyright registration is required.

You may read-up on "Content Ownership" at Account and submission guidelines at Adobe Stock . The links will give you more details regarding what uploads will require Property, or Model Releases.
